Toncoin cryptocurrency suffered significant losses after the arrest of Telegram's founder
According to Bloomberg, the cryptocurrency Toncoin lost 2.7 billion dollars of its capitalization value after the detention of Telegram's founder Pavel Durov.
Toncoin, which was created by Pavel Durov, suffered significant losses but did not lose popularity.
The minimum price for the cryptocurrency was recorded on August 25 at 11:05 AM - 5.34 dollars. In contrast, on August 24, Toncoin was worth 6.8 dollars. Thus, in one day, the price of this cryptocurrency sharply dropped by nearly 20%.
